What Factors Influence the Availability of Cheap Flight Deals?

Several factors influence the availability of cheap flight deals.

  1. Demand and supply dynamics
  2. Airline competition
  3. Booking timing
  4. Seasonality
  5. Geographic factors
  6. Special promotions and discounts
  7. Economic conditions

Understanding these factors may provide insights from different perspectives, including varying market conditions and consumer behaviors. Next, let’s explore each factor in detail to gain a deeper understanding.

  1. Demand and Supply Dynamics: Demand and supply dynamics significantly impact flight deals. When demand is low and supply is high, airlines often reduce prices to encourage bookings. Conversely, high demand with limited seat availability can drive prices up. A study by the International Air Transport Association (IATA) in 2021 found that managing capacity effectively can lead to better price flexibility.

  2. Airline Competition: Airline competition plays a crucial role in price determination. More airlines serving the same route typically results in lower fares as they compete for passengers. According to the U.S. Department of Transportation, routes with multiple carriers often have prices that are 20% lower than those with a single airline. This competitive environment benefits consumers through lower prices and more flight options.

  3. Booking Timing: Booking timing is critical for securing cheap flights. Studies indicate that booking tickets well in advance, usually 1-3 months before departure, can result in lower prices. According to a 2020 study by CheapAir, the optimal time to book is approximately 70 days before departure for domestic flights.

  4. Seasonality: Seasonality influences flight prices. Peak travel seasons, such as summer vacations and holiday periods, typically see higher fares due to increased demand. In contrast, flights during off-peak times are often cheaper. A study by Hopper in 2021 noted that travelers could save up to 40% by flying during the off-peak season.

  5. Geographic Factors: Geographic factors can also affect flight availability and pricing. Airports in major metropolitan areas usually have higher traffic and more flight options, leading to competitive pricing. Conversely, flights to remote locations may have fewer options, driving prices up. For instance, trade data from Airlines for America shows that flights into the New York region are often cheaper due to multiple airlines competing.

  6. Special Promotions and Discounts: Airlines frequently run special promotions and discounts to attract customers. These offers, which can include flash sales or loyalty program discounts, present opportunities for travelers to find cheap flights. A 2019 study by the Airline Reporting Corporation found that promotional fares can lower ticket prices by up to 30%.

  7. Economic Conditions: Economic conditions can influence travel behaviors and flight pricing. In times of economic downturns, consumer spending on travel tends to decrease, leading airlines to lower prices to stimulate demand. A report by the World Bank in 2020 highlighted that during recessions, airline ticket prices may drop significantly as airlines attempt to maintain passenger volumes.

By understanding these factors, travelers can make more informed decisions and increase their chances of finding budget-friendly flight deals.

Why Should I Look for Alternative Airports When Searching for Cheap Flights?

Looking for alternative airports can significantly lower your flight costs. Major airports often charge higher fees for airlines, which can lead to increased ticket prices. Smaller or secondary airports may offer cheaper options due to lower operating costs and fees.

According to the International Air Transport Association (IATA), alternative airports often provide competitive pricing not available at larger hubs. IATA studies indicate that these airports may have different pricing strategies based on demand and competition.

Several factors contribute to the lower prices at alternative airports. First, these airports typically experience less traffic. Less demand can drive airlines to lower prices to attract more passengers. Second, the fees charged to airlines at smaller airports often are lower than those at major hubs. Airlines may pass these savings on to customers, resulting in lower fare options.

When discussing “operating costs,” it refers to the expenses airlines incur for using an airport, including landing fees and terminal charges. “Demand” relates to how many people want to fly from a given location. When demand is low, airlines have more incentive to reduce prices.

Specific conditions influence the pricing of flights from alternative airports. For example, if there are fewer airlines serving an airport, it may lead to less competition for fares. Conversely, if multiple airlines compete for passengers at a smaller airport, this can force prices down. A scenario might be comparing a flight from a major city’s airport and a nearby smaller airport; passengers may find a significant price difference due to these factors.
